About the project / Job summary
|
|
The Construction Material Controller is responsible
for material management at Site, collecting all the documents and
certification covering the arrival of materials at site and provides for
recording of their movements.
Construction Material Controller supplies the Site
Control Manager with elements enabling the feasibility analysis of the
construction programs.
|
|
Duties and responsibilities
|
- Arrange warehouse logistics according to the instructions of the
Site Manager.
- Manage information relevant to arrival of materials at site and
their availability at the warehouse.
- Coordinate the availability of shipping documentation and feed
the warehouse data base with proper information.
- Co-ordinate any necessary action to support customs clearance of
materials.
- Manage the receiving, check, storage and preservation of
materials delivered at Site.
- Manage the receiving, check, recording and traceability of
material certificates.
- Issue any supply non-conformities and follow-up the relevant
resolution.
- Initiate procedures concerning insurance claims for damage to
materials during transport to Site or during erection.
- Start the application for insurance claims related to materials
damaged during transportation or erection.
- Initiate claims against vendors for missing materials and/or
non-conformity with the relevant purchase order.
- Supply Site Planner with updated information regarding materials
availability at site to support the construction schedule reliability.
- Inform Site Control Manager/Coordinator about plant material
status and delivery forecasts, in order to verify the feasibility of
Construction schedules.
- Manage the delivery of materials to Subcontractors in accordance
with material list presented by the same and according to the
instructions given by the Supervisors.
- Keep records about the handling of materials, using corporate
software systems.
- Perform feasibility analysis by the Company Software System.
- Keep on records of surplus materials for possible sale at the end
of the job.
